When troubleshooting lift technology for slow operation problems, a systematic technique to recognizing the source is crucial. Slow operation can be triggered by numerous variables, consisting of mechanical concerns, electric issues, and even concerns with the control system. The initial step in determining the root cause of slow-moving operation is to carry out an aesthetic evaluation of the lift components. Look for any indicators of wear and tear, such as torn cables, dripping hydraulic liquid, or damaged sheaves.

Next, check the electric links to ensure that all elements are correctly attached and operating. Defective wiring or loose connections can lead to slow down operation or complete malfunction of the lift system. In addition, it is essential to check the control system to establish if the issue hinges on the programs or sensors.

If the aesthetic evaluation and electric checks do not expose the source of the sluggish procedure, additional analysis tests may be necessary. Taking On Hydraulic System Malfunctions

The effectiveness of hydraulic systems in lifts relies heavily on the correct functioning of various elements within the system. When hydraulic systems breakdown in lifts, it can cause operational disturbances and security issues. One typical issue is hydraulic fluid leak, which can take place due to damaged seals, loose connections, or damaged cyndrical tubes. To tackle this problem, professionals need to carry out a detailed inspection to identify the resource of the leakage and replace any type of damaged elements immediately.

An additional frequent hydraulic system malfunction is a loss of pressure, which can result from air entering the system, liquid contamination, or pump ineffectiveness. Service technicians can resolve this by hemorrhaging the system to remove air, changing polluted fluid, or servicing the pump view as needed. Furthermore, abnormalities in hydraulic liquid degrees or uncommon sounds during lift procedure might show underlying system malfunctions that require instant focus to stop additional damages. Routine upkeep and prompt troubleshooting of hydraulic system concerns are essential to making certain the safe and reliable procedure of lift innovation.

Handling Electric Part Failures

Dealing with electric part failures in lift modern technology requires an organized technique to detecting and solving issues to maintain functional capability and safety standards. When experiencing electric troubles in lift systems, it is essential to initial conduct a detailed examination of the electrical elements, consisting of control board, circuitry, sensors, and circuit boards. Any type of indicators of damage, rust, loose connections, or charred elements must be carefully kept in mind and dealt with promptly to stop more complications.

When it comes to electric component failures, it is essential to adhere to maker guidelines for repairing and repair procedures. This may entail evaluating the components using multimeters, oscilloscopes, or various other analysis tools to identify the precise source of the malfunction. Furthermore, having an extensive understanding of the lift's electrical schematics and circuitry layouts can aid in identifying and fixing concerns successfully.

Normal maintenance and evaluation schedules can aid prevent electric failures by discovering potential concerns at an early stage. Appropriate training for lift technicians on electrical systems and parts is likewise vital to guarantee exact diagnosis and effective resolution of electric issues, ultimately adding to the general security and integrity of lift procedures.
